Understanding the Appeal of Vector Formats
Unlike raster images, which pixelate when enlarged, a mascot world cup 2026 vector file uses mathematical paths to define shapes and colors. This technical advantage makes it the ideal choice for merchandise printing, web animation, and large-format signage. The clean lines and editable nature of vectors provide a professionalism that is essential for official promotional materials and fan projects alike.
